Inside the story of Four Women in the Harem
The narrative of Four Women in the Harem unfolds like this: Sadık Pasha is a pleasure-loving and pious pasha who lives in a luxurious Ottoman mansion with his three wives. The balance of the mansion, already full of intrigue with three women, is completely disrupted when he wants to take a fourth wife, thinking that he needs to continue his lineage because he has no children.

Cast and characters of Four Women in the Harem
Four Women in the Harem is anchored by Tanju Gürsu, Nilüfer Aydan, Pervin Par, and Cüneyt Arkın, working under the direction of Halit Refiğ. The chemistry between the leads is one of the production's quiet strengths.
The script comes from Kemal Tahir, whose writing keeps the dialogue sharp. You can trace the full credits and filmographies on IMDb and TMDB.
